Silver Oaks sits in southwest Tulsa, in the 74107 zip code west of the Arkansas River, with streets like Silver Oak Drive and Silver Oak Place anchoring the addition. The area falls inside the Jenks school district boundary and connects to the rest of the metro through the U.S. 75 corridor, which puts downtown Tulsa within a straightforward commute and keeps the west-bank side of the river - including the trail systems around Turkey Mountain to the northeast - close at hand.
The housing stock dates mostly from 1975 to 1986, and these are big houses for their era. The median sold home over the last six months measured about 3,405 square feet - among the largest median footprints of any subdivision we track in the Tulsa metro. At a median of $106 per square foot, Silver Oaks delivers more space per dollar than nearly any comparable south or southwest Tulsa neighborhood.
The market here covers a wide band. 8 homes sold in the six months ending 08/31/2026, at prices from $115,000 up to $400,000 - a spread that reflects real variety in lot size, condition, and updates from one street to the next. The median landed at $377,500. Sales ran a median 30 days on market, a slower pace than the metro average, which is common in neighborhoods where homes are larger and pricing depends heavily on condition. That makes accurate, house-specific pricing matter more here, not less.
